Up for sale is my 1969 Mercedes Benz 280SL Pagoda Roadster which needs finishing and reassembly. Previous owner had the car since 2008 and had been working on it and then lost interest. He purchased many new parts such as new canvas top, all seals, rechromed light bezels, brand new interior mahogany wood set which he said cost more than $1000, new rubber mats for interior of trunk and car, new exhaust system still in the box, and many miscellaneous pieces which carry the Mercedes Benz tag. All parts appear to be present: all dash gauges, radio, speedometer, tachometer, rectangular gauge, clock which previous owner says works, glove box door, all dash vent pieces and knobs and interior/exterior chrome pieces and latches, bumpers, door handles, door regulators and door parts, front grill, Bosch horns, air cleaner, new engine insulation kit and the list goes on.  The car also has an under dash air conditioning system present. It has all pieces except the compressor. There is no windshield with the car. Also present are a pair of Euro headlights which go with the car.

THERE ARE 2 ENGINES WHICH GO WITH THE CAR!! The original was disassembled and sent to the machine shop. It has been machined and the engine parts were degreased. All engine parts are present. You will see the engine in the pictures. It is complete and has the Bosch mechanical fuel injection. The other engine is a 280SL engine which came out of a running car. It is totally ASSEMBLED. It has the Bosch mechanical fuel injection on the engine. Again, the car comes with 2 engines! There are also 2 Bosch distributors which are present. The transmission and torque converter are present. Previous owner said transmission shifted well.

The car was sent to the body shop and had new floors and trunk pan welded in. The metal work that was done on the car was done very well,  high quality. After the body work was done the car was then painted 1969 Mercedes Benz Silver. This is the silver that Mercedes used in 1969 on the 280SL.  All panels look good, doors close well with even gap, hood fits well and trunk lid and convertible top lid fit well. The paint work looks good on the car. The work that was done on the welded-in panels looks good. Frame is super solid and clean.

Underneath the car was cleaned. New shocks were installed and the wheels were media blasted and then powder coated black. New tires were installed.

This is a re-assembly project!  The car rolls and can be loaded up on a trailer. All parts can be boxed and placed inside of car. This will make a beautiful car when it is done!

Mercedes testing C-Class plug-in hybrid modes in Germany

Wed, 07 May 2014

Testing appears to be underway for what would be the first Mercedes-Benz C-Class with a hybrid powertrain. We can see a pair of the prototypes undergoing testing in Germany, with one, a C-Class Wagon, still heavily clad in camouflage and featuring a more noticeable outlet on the passenger side of its rear bumper.
There's also a more production-looking sedan, which features a not-so-discreet flap over its rear-bumper outlet. It's difficult to speculate on power outputs for this fuel-sipping C-Class, although our spies seem to think that this car will feature some combination of a four-cylinder gas engine with an electric motor, although just which four is unclear (note, we wouldn't mind if MB fit its 2.0-liter turbo with some batteries and motors). Regardless, the four-pot/electric motor seems like a pretty reasonable combo, although it probably means that Mercedes won't be challenging the six-cylinder-powered system of the BMW ActiveHybrid3 any time soon.
When the plug-in C-Class arrives later this year as a 2015 model, it will likely offer a full range of driving modes, including both gas or electric, only, as well as a more traditional hybrid mode.

Rare Isdera Imperator 108i flexes its considerable muscles

Mon, 05 Aug 2013

The Isdera Imperator 108i is a remarkably rare supercar from the late 80s and early 90s. Born of a Mercedes-Benz concept car, it's powered by a range of AMG-developed V8s, with five to six liters of displacement, depending on the engine. The example shown here, lapping the legendary Spa-Francorchamps circuit, features the most potent 6.0-liter V8 available. And rather than just being driven about on a perfectly clean racing line, it's freaking power sliding!
Yes, there's something eternally childlike about a wedge-shaped supercar from our formative years being flung about a Belgian racetrack. Adding to the appeal is the Imperator's stumpy, periscopic rear mirror, sticking out of the roof. Even after being out of production for 20 years, this is still a wild, wild car and we'd happily snap up the opportunity pilot one of the 36 Isderas that were built.
